1. Introduction to Cryptocurrency
Cryptocurrency is a digital or virtual form of currency that uses cryptography for security. Unlike traditional fiat currencies, cryptocurrencies operate independently of any central authority and are typically based on blockchain technology. This decentralized nature makes cryptocurrencies a popular choice for those seeking financial freedom and privacy.

4.1 Decentralized Applications (DApps)
Ethereum's smart contract functionality has paved the way for the development of decentralized applications. These DApps offer various functionalities, from gaming to financial services, without the need for intermediaries. This potential has attracted numerous developers and investors to the Ethereum platform.
4.2 Decentralized Finance (DeFi)
Ethereum has been a key player in the DeFi space, which is an emerging sector within the cryptocurrency ecosystem. DeFi aims to replicate traditional financial services, such as lending, borrowing, and trading, in a decentralized manner. Ethereum's platform has facilitated the growth of DeFi projects, offering users new and innovative financial solutions.
4.3 Scalability
One of the challenges faced by Ethereum is scalability. The platform has experienced network congestion and high transaction fees during peak times. However, Ethereum's upcoming upgrade, known as Ethereum 2.0, aims to address this issue by transitioning to a proof-of-stake consensus mechanism and increasing the network's capacity.

1. What is the primary purpose of Ethereum?
Answer: The primary purpose of Ethereum is to enable the creation and execution of smart contracts and decentralized applications (DApps) on its blockchain platform.
2. How does Ethereum differ from Bitcoin?
Answer: Ethereum differs from Bitcoin in that it focuses on decentralized applications and smart contracts, while Bitcoin is primarily a digital currency.
